What’s the difference between Aluminum and Steel?

Aluminum vs Steel

Feature Aluminum Steel
Weight Lightweight (~1/3 of steel) Heavy, high density
Strength Moderate (high strength-to-weight) Very high strength
Corrosion Resistance Excellent (natural oxide layer) Requires coating or treatment
Machinability Excellent Good
Weldability Good (requires technique) Excellent
Cost Higher per lb More economical
Best For Lightweight, corrosion-resistant applications Structural, heavy-duty applications
